Q: How does LiftWeave's dispatch simulator protect its saved scenario bundles? A: Scenario bundles are encrypted at rest, and the simulator never transmits them off the workstation. Reviewers auditing the Harrowgate test bench can decrypt archived bundles only with the recovery credential held by the simulation lead. For this review copy, the passphrase is provided directly below.

strongbox words: praath-queniel-holax-druael-jorath-noveth-druok

Quarterly Planning Note — Customer Concentration

Branch managers: Torvald Mechanics now accounts for 34% of Ridgeline Components' revenue. Too high. Targets this quarter: grow mid-tier accounts 12%, open six new prospects per branch, no exclusive terms for any single buyer. Report progress biweekly. The strategic rationale is summarized in the confidential note below.

confidential, kagup-bafog: Fraaxax Group is in early talks to buy Soroxox Group for about $343.8 million. The Olidor launch date is June 14, and nothing goes to the press before then. Legal wants the Aldmirek Logistics term sheet signed before July 23.

- [ ] Step 7: Archive cold storage buckets (Glacierline tier). Confirm both ceremony witnesses are present, verify bucket manifests match the Oxbow ledger, then seal the archive key shares. Plugin authors may observe but not handle shares. Once sealed, the archive index itself is encrypted and can only be reopened with the passphrase below.

vault phrase of badup-hahig = tamael-aldael-kelmir-istael-fenok-istwyn-tamius-jorath-oliion